Job description

Job Overview

The RUH Bath NHS Foundation Trust provides acute treatment and care for a catchment population of around 500,000 people in Bath, and the surrounding towns and villages in North East Somerset and Western Wiltshire.

The Biochemistry department processes a high workload (around 4000 requests per day) and the laboratory is UKAS accredited. We operate a 24/7 service and staff are expected to support the out of hours service under Agenda for Change terms and conditions. There are a minimum of 2 BMS staff working in Biochemistry on every shift. The Biochemistry Department has a Beckman based Automation section (1xAU5812, 1xAU5822, 2xDXI800s and a full DxA track), Sebia electrophoresis equipment. The IT systems used at the RUH are Cirdan Ultra LIMS, Sunquest ICE, Cerner Millennium and QPulse. Main duties of the job

  • Performance of specialist scientific and technical duties, as required, to the standard expected of a State Registered BMS.
  • To use and maintain the integrity of the laboratory computer systems and their databases for data entry of requests, recording and reporting all results, compiling reports and other documents, and for communication (email).
  • Ensure that all analyses are performed to the highest standard using approved methods and Quality Control systems
  • Use specialist knowledge to perform analytical techniques in each section of the department, recording and interpreting complex array of Quality Control data according to departmental policy; to use specialist knowledge to interpret this array of data in order to identify changes in system performance and take corrective action when appropriate.
  • To combine specialist knowledge and the quality control data to decide when abnormal results need to be reviewed and to authorise and release results and to report by telephone when required by designated action limits.
  • With section BMS2, organise and plan daily workload to provide the most efficient and effective service and to fit in with the needs of the department.
  • Ensure confidentiality in relation to matters arising with patients and their treatment is strictly observed.
  • Ensures compliance with the code of practice of the Department regarding Health and Safety especially with regard to handling and disposal of high risk material.
